Wallbridge evacuates Fenelon camp due to wildfires

2023-06-05 11:28 ET - News Release

Mr. Marz Kord reports

WALLBRIDGE TEMPORARILY EVACUATES FENELON CAMP, SUSPENDS EXPLORATION DUE TO QUEBEC FOREST FIRE RISK

Wallbridge Mining Company Ltd. has temporarily evacuated the camp at its 100-per-cent-owned Fenelon gold project and suspended all exploration activities on its Detour-Fenelon gold trend property due to an emergency order from the Quebec Ministere des Ressources naturelles et des Forets (Ministry of Natural Resources and Forests) prohibiting access to lands in the province impacted by forest fires.

"Safety is of paramount importance at Wallbridge," said Marz Kord, president and chief executive officer. "All of our employees and contractors' staff have been safely evacuated, and we have taken appropriate measures to secure and mitigate risk to the Fenelon camp site. Exploration activities at Fenelon and our other projects will resume as soon as practicable."

The news release from the Ministere des Ressources naturelles et des Forets (Ministry of Natural Resources and Forests) announcing the prohibition can be found on-line.

About Wallbridge Mining Company Ltd.

Wallbridge is focused on creating value through the exploration and sustainable development of gold projects along the Detour-Fenelon gold trend while respecting the environment and communities where it operates.

Wallbridge's flagship project, Fenelon gold, is located on the highly prospective Detour-Fenelon gold trend property in Quebec's northern Abitibi region. An updated mineral resource estimate completed in January, 2023, yielded significantly improved grades and additional ounces at the 100-per-cent-owned Fenelon and Martiniere properties, incorporating a combined 3.05 million ounces of indicated gold resources and 2.35 million ounces of inferred gold resources. Fenelon and Martiniere are located within an approximate 830-square-kilometre exploration land package controlled by Wallbridge. The company believes that these two deposits have good potential for economic development, especially given their proximity to existing hydroelectric power and transportation infrastructure. In addition, Wallbridge believes that the extensive land package is extremely prospective for the discovery of additional gold deposits.

Wallbridge also holds a 19.9-per-cent interest in the common shares of Archer Exploration Corp. as a result of the sale of the company's portfolio of nickel assets in Ontario and Quebec in November of 2022.

Wallbridge will continue to focus on its core Detour-Fenelon gold trend property while enabling shareholders to participate in the potential economic upside in Archer.
